Comprehensive Guide to pre-procedure record form

What is the Pre-Procedure Record Form?

The Pre-Procedure Record Form is essential in the healthcare process, serving to ensure patient safety and preparedness before surgical interventions. This form collects vital information that helps medical staff assess a patient's health status and readiness for surgery.
This patient information form encompasses several key sections: personal details, anesthesia history, a health survey, current medications, and previous surgeries. Completing all sections accurately is crucial for an effective evaluation of the patient's condition.

The Pre-Procedure Record Form must be completed by patients or guardians of minors who are scheduled for surgical procedures to ensure all relevant medical information is available.
Before completing the form, gather details about your personal data, medical history, current medications, any allergies, and details of previous surgeries or medical procedures.
You can submit the form either by downloading and printing it to take to your appointment or by emailing it directly to your healthcare provider after completing it on pdfFiller.
If you make a mistake on the Pre-Procedure Record Form, simply use pdfFiller’s tools to correct the information. Review the form thoroughly before finalizing and saving.
It is advisable to complete the Pre-Procedure Record Form as soon as possible before your procedure, ideally a few days prior to ensure your healthcare provider has enough time to review your information.
No, the Pre-Procedure Record Form does not require notarization. It must only be signed by the patient or guardian.
